On my mini room fit makes me an EQ.
On my Ultra room fit is a separate thing and I can have none, either, or both.
If I have both, is room fit applying the curve it generated to my eq setting as if that was flat? Or is my EQ adjusting my room fit curve as though that was flat? Or are they averaging out?
Or neither? Or both? Or something else?
It's not an issue, I just wondered

On the Ultra the RoomFit EQ is first applied and then the user EQ is applied on top of that.

On the Mini only one EQ is applied.

The Mini does not yet feature the separate RoomFit and EQ functions. The relationship between EQ and RoomFit for other models is as follows:

[RoomFit : On / EQ : Off]
Only RoomFit's filters add to the sound.
[RoomFit : Off / EQ : On]
Only EQ filters add to the sound.
[RoomFit : On / EQ : On]
Both filters are added to the sound.

In other words, if the EQ is flat and RoomFit is turned on, the RoomFit filter is applied. When RoomFit is on and acoustic EQ is used, the EQ is applied on top of the RoomFit filter.
